The HQ Series is for water quality professionals who want to perform electrochemical analysis for field and lab environments. Our new portable platform will allow you to collect intuitive, accurate measurements, manage data, and easily review results, while supplying an IP67 robustness rating. They provide a true rugged, field-ready solution with on-screen, visual step-by-step operating guidance that provides users with confidence in reporting and managing their results. Unlike other field meters with basic user interfaces and without easily accessible data, the HQ Series secures, simplifies, and accelerates the complete measurement process for field users. Choose from 4 models, including the three-input HQ4000 series, dual-input HQ2000 series, and single-input HQ1000 series. These meters offer a range in measurement versatility - eliminating the need for multiple pieces of equipment.

  • Most measuring issues are due to incorrect calibration procedures. With our illustrated, step-by-step on-screen calibration and troubleshooting procedures, water quality professionals can succeed every time.

  • Whether you are at your facility or working in the field, the Hach<sup>®</sup> HQ Series portable meter ensures your data will be safely transferred via USB.

  • We offer standard laboratory and rugged field IntelliCAL smart sensors available with the HQ Series to measure a wide variety of parameters including Total Dissolved Solids (TDS), Optical Dissolved Oxygen (DO), Biochemical Oxygen Demand (BOD), Temperature, Conductivity, and pH. IntelliCAL smart probes are automatically recognized by HQ meters, retain calibration history and method settings to minimize errors and setup time.

Product Specifications

Warranty 12 months
Display Up to 3 parameters at a time, dependent on HQ model
Power supply Rechargeable lithium-ion battery 18650 (internal) Class II, USB power adapter: 100 - 240 VAC
Probe type Intellical Standard Laboratory or Rugged Field
Calibration Intervals/Alerts/Reminder Off, selectable from 2 hours to 7 days
Backlight Yes
Auto-Buffer Recognition Yes
Display Lock Function Continuous / Auto-stabilization ("press to read") / At Interval
Data Export USB connection to PC or USB storage device (limited to the storage device capacity).
Storage Conditions -20 - 60 °C, max. 90% relative humidity (non-condensing)
ISE Direct Measurement No
Data Storage Automatic in Press to Read Mode and Interval Mode. Manual in Continuous Read Mode.
Inputs 1
GLP features Date; Time; Sample ID; Operator ID, Calibration
Temperature Resolution 0.1 °C
TDS Measurement 0.00 mg/L - 50.0 g/L NaCl
TDS Resolution 0.01 mg/L - 0.1 g/L upon measuring range
ISE Electrode Calibration No
Instrument Portable
Sensor A PHC20101
Sensor B None
Sensor C None
Salinity Resolution 0.01 (ppt) (‰)
Salinity Measurement 0 - 42 (ppt) (‰)
Protection Class IEC Class III (SELV (Separated/Safety Extra-Low Voltage) powered); external
Probes Included? PHC20101
Measurement Method Probe specific programmed method settings
pH Measurement Range 0 - 14 pH
pH Electrode Calibration 1 - 3 Calibration points Calibration summary data logged and displayed
pH Resolution Selectable: 0.001/0.01/0.1 pH
pH Buffer Sets Color-coded: 4.01, 7.00, 10.01 pH; IUPAC: 1.679, 4.005, 7.000, 10.012, 12.45 pH
ORP Electrode Calibration Predefined ORP standards (including Zobell's solution)
Operating Interface Soft Touch Keypad
mV Resolution 0.1 mV
mV Measurement at Stable Reading Yes
Temperature compensation Automatic Temperature compensation for pH
Parameters pH/Oxidation Reduction Potential (ORP)
